Given: Parallel resistors arrangement

           R₁ = 5 ohm

           R₂ = 10 ohm

           Such 8 sets connected in series.

To FInd: Equivalent resistance = R

Solution:

Formulas used:

Equivalent resistance for parallel resistors - R'

1/R' = 1/R₁ + 1/R₂

Equivalent resistance for resistors connected in series - R''

R'' = R₁ + R₂

Note:  The Equivalent resistance of two resistors of 5 ohms and 10 ohms connected in parallel would then be series to each other when 8 such sets are connected.

Applying the above formulas:

1/R' = 1/R₁ + 1/R₂

     = 1/5 + 1/10

     =2 + 1/10

     = 3/10

R' = 10/3= 3.33

R for 8 such sets connected in series:

R = 8 × 3.33

   = 26.67 ohms

Hence the equivalent resistance of the given connection of resistors is 26.67 ohms.
